Enhancement of the electron electric dipole moment in gadolinium 3+

There have been recent suggestions for searching for the electron electric dipole moment, using solid state experiments with compounds containing Gd 3+ ions. These experiments could improve the sensitivity compared to present atomic and molecular experiments by several orders of magnitude. The analysis of the problem requires a calculation of the enhancement coefficient K for the electron electric dipole moment in the Gd 3+ ion. In this work we perform this calculation. The result is K = -4.9 +- 1.6. Limitations of the accuracy of the calculation are mainly due to the lack of data on Gd 3+ excitation spectra. We formulate which quantities have to be measured and/or calculated to improve the accuracy.
